Comprehending Registered Representatives

A licensed agent is a entity or corporation entity appointed to accept official papers and formal notices on behalf of a firm. This entails notifications regarding service of process, periodic compliance regulations, and other critical juridical documents. Official agents serve as the designated contact point for correspondence between a firm and the state, ensuring that companies stay within the law with regional regulations and statutes.

Each business organization, whether an Limited Liability Company or corporation, is typically required to appoint a registered representative as part of its formation process. The registered representative must have a real place within the jurisdiction of establishment and must be accessible during standard business hours to collect documents. This requirement helps maintain clarity and responsibility in the corporate environment, as it provides a trustworthy means for government regulators to reach a firm if necessary.

Common Misconceptions

One widespread belief about registered agents is that they are only necessary for large corporations. In reality, each business entity, including small LLCs and startups, must designate a registered agent. This requirement is key for maintaining favorable standing with the state and ensuring that the business gets important legal documents. No matter if you are operating as a sole proprietor or operating a large corporation, having a reliable registered agent is essential.

Another myth claims that registered agents simply deal with legal documents and service of process. Though this represents a major part of their responsibilities, registered agents also provide a range of business support services. These can include compliance reminders, document handling, and occasionally annual report filings. Opting for the right registered agent can help to streamline compliance management and ensure your business stays on track.

Regulatory Compliance and Compliance

Understanding the lawful obligations surrounding designated agents is crucial for corporate adherence. Most jurisdictions in the United States mandate that every company, whether it is an Limited Company or a corporate entity, designate a registered agent to handle legal notices and government notices. This is a core requirement for maintaining good standing; noncompliance to comply can result in penalties or revocation of status of the company.

Legal representatives must fulfill specific state requirements, including being reachable during regular business hours and having a location within the state of registration. Many startups opt to hire certified agent companies to ensure they meet these duties. This not only facilitates the adherence process but also provides a layer of confidentiality, as the designated agent's address is openly disclosed rather than the owner's residential address.
